The concept of my final project is to create a multi-functional space that serves as a jewelry shop, art gallery, and office. The unique aspect of this design is that the office is situated within the jewelry shop to create a collaborative environment where workers can inspire each other.
The concept is based on the idea of “Grid,” which will be used to design jewelry collections. This theme will be incorporated throughout the space to create a cohesive look and feel.
The building is another branch of the Royal Birmingham Society of Artists, adding a new function to the old one. This will attract a wide range of visitors, including the public and merchants.
The space is designed to showcase the jewelry collections in an artistic and visually appealing manner. The art gallery will feature rotating exhibitions to keep visitors engaged and excited.
The office space is open and collaborative, with shared workspaces and meeting areas. This will encourage workers to share ideas and inspire each other.
Overall, this multi-functional space provides a unique and engaging experience for visitors while also fostering a creative and collaborative environment for workers.
